Assam Agricultural University: Advancing Agricultural Education and Research in Northeast India

 

Introduction

Assam Agricultural University (AAU), located in Jorhat, Assam, is the first and foremost institution for agricultural education in the northeastern part of India. Established on April 1, 1969, under the Assam Agricultural University Act of 1968, AAU has made significant contributions to the agricultural landscape of Assam and Northeast India at large. The university aims to empower the region's agricultural sector through cutting-edge research, education, and extension services tailored to the local needs.

AAU's primary mission is to improve agricultural productivity, rural development, and sustainable farming practices through specialized programs and research. With its broad network of research stations and expertise in various fields, AAU is a leading center for agricultural studies and innovation in the region.


History and Establishment

Assam Agricultural University was founded with the purpose of imparting agricultural education and developing technologies suited to the agricultural needs of Assam and neighboring regions. The university was established as a result of the increasing demand for trained professionals in agriculture, veterinary sciences, and allied fields.

Before the establishment of AAU, the region lacked an institution that could cater specifically to the agricultural needs of the northeastern states. The creation of AAU addressed this gap by introducing comprehensive programs and research initiatives tailored to the local challenges of farming and rural development.


Academic Programs and Faculties

Assam Agricultural University offers a range of undergraduate, postgraduate, and doctoral programs in agricultural and allied sciences. These programs are designed to provide students with theoretical knowledge and practical skills required to succeed in the agricultural industry.

1. Faculty of Agriculture

The Faculty of Agriculture is the backbone of AAU, offering various programs focused on sustainable agricultural practices. The faculty provides education in disciplines like:

  • Agronomy
  • Horticulture
  • Soil Science
  • Plant Pathology
  • Agricultural Economics

The programs are designed to provide students with the tools to tackle challenges in crop management, soil fertility, and environmental sustainability.

2. Faculty of Veterinary Science

The Faculty of Veterinary Science focuses on the health and management of livestock. Programs offered include:

  • Bachelor of Veterinary Science (B.V.Sc.)
  • Master of Veterinary Science (M.V.Sc.)
  • Doctoral Programs in Veterinary Science

The faculty aims to equip students with the knowledge to manage animal health, improve livestock productivity, and enhance food security in rural areas.

3. Faculty of Fisheries Science

This faculty is dedicated to promoting sustainable fish farming and aquatic resource management. Programs in Fisheries Science cover areas such as:

  • Aquaculture
  • Fish Biology
  • Fish Technology

The faculty focuses on improving fish production and managing water bodies effectively, contributing to food security and rural employment.

4. Faculty of Community Science

The Faculty of Community Science addresses the human aspects of agricultural development. Programs include:

  • Human Development
  • Food Science and Nutrition
  • Resource Management

This faculty focuses on improving the quality of life and living standards in rural areas, with an emphasis on nutrition, family welfare, and resource management.

5. Faculty of Sericulture

The Faculty of Sericulture focuses on the cultivation of silkworms and the production of silk. This program is vital for rural economies, especially in the northeastern states, which are known for sericulture. The faculty offers both undergraduate and postgraduate programs in sericulture.


Research and Extension Services

Assam Agricultural University is deeply committed to research and extension services, with a focus on improving agricultural productivity, sustainability, and food security in the region. The university has set up several research stations and extension programs to bring its research findings directly to farmers.

 

Research Stations

AAU operates a network of Regional Agricultural Research Stations (RARS) spread across Assam, including in locations like Titabar, North Lakhimpur, Diphu, and Karimganj. These stations conduct research focused on regional agricultural practices, soil health, crop management, and pest control.

 

Krishi Vigyan Kendras (KVKs)

The university also operates 23 Krishi Vigyan Kendras (KVKs) across the state of Assam. These centers play a crucial role in technology transfer, providing farmers with knowledge about modern agricultural practices, pest management, and sustainable farming techniques.

Research and Development Initiatives

AAU is involved in research in various areas such as:

  • Climate-smart agriculture
  • Integrated farming systems
  • Pest and disease management
  • Water management

The university actively collaborates with national and international research organizations, including the Indian Council of Agricultural Research (ICAR), to promote cutting-edge agricultural research.


Rankings and Recognition

Assam Agricultural University has earned a prestigious reputation for its academic excellence, research, and extension work. In the National Institutional Ranking Framework (NIRF) 2024, AAU secured the 14th position in the Agriculture category, reflecting its strong performance in teaching, research, and outreach activities. This ranking highlights the university's role as a leading agricultural institution in India.


Admission Process

The admission process at AAU is highly structured and competitive, aimed at selecting students with a genuine interest in agricultural sciences. The admission process includes:

  • Undergraduate Programs: Students are admitted through an entrance exam conducted by the university or based on merit. The university conducts a state-level entrance examination for various programs in agriculture and allied sciences.
  • Postgraduate Programs: Admission to postgraduate courses is based on a combination of merit and an entrance examination.
  • Doctoral Programs: Candidates seeking admission to Ph.D. programs must have a Master’s degree in a relevant discipline, and they are selected based on performance in an entrance exam and personal interview.

Scholarships and Financial Aid

Assam Agricultural University offers various scholarships and financial assistance to deserving students. Scholarships are awarded based on:

  • Merit: Top-performing students are awarded scholarships based on academic excellence.
  • Financial Need: Students from economically weaker backgrounds can avail themselves of financial aid.

Additionally, the university provides stipends to students enrolled in postgraduate and doctoral programs.


Placement and Career Opportunities

Assam Agricultural University has a dedicated placement cell that helps students secure employment after completing their programs. The placement cell works closely with industry partners, agricultural organizations, and government agencies to provide students with job opportunities in both the private and public sectors.

Graduates from AAU are employed in a variety of roles, including:

  • Agricultural Research
  • Rural Development
  • Veterinary Services
  • Fisheries Management
  • Agro-based Industries

Many graduates also choose to start their own ventures in farming, agribusiness, or animal husbandry, contributing to the region's rural economy.
